c# mvc3模型绑定时bool类型值如何由checkbox更新后传给后台action

问题描述

c# mvc3模型绑定时bool类型值如何由checkbox更新后传给后台action

???单击复选框后@Model.checkItem的值应能更新,但确不能???

解决方案

 在服务器上
ActionResult 你的方法(FormCollection fc)
{
    fc["checkItem"]
}
或者
ActionResult 你的方法(你的模型 model)
{
    UpdateModel(); //这个不写不会更新
        model.checkItem
}

解决方案二:

谢谢。但我怀疑"value=@Model.checkItem"是这种写法有问题。

时间: 2024-09-20 12:35:14

c# mvc3模型绑定时bool类型值如何由checkbox更新后传给后台action的相关文章

多进程读写long类型值

问题描述 多进程读写long类型值 windows下,一个进程不停地写共享内存的一个long类型变量值,另外一个进程不停地 读取该变量值做if判断,这个时候可能该值既不是0也不是1么? 解决方案 基本类型写入的时候应该是原子操作的.所以应该是0或1 解决方案二: 看你写的数是什么,只有0.1? 为了安全读取数,应该做个握手信号,我写,你就别读.等我写完你再读. 解决方案三: 只写0和1,这是在实现自旋锁时遇到的一个问题,加锁时:InterlockedCompareExchange(long变量地

java-EditText.getText()方法中返回Editable类型值有何作用?

问题描述 EditText.getText()方法中返回Editable类型值有何作用? 根据说明,EditText的getText()方法返回值Editable,这有什么特别的用处么?能不能用返回string类型代替? 官方对editable的说明: This is the interface for text whose content and markup can be changed (as opposed to immutable text like Strings). 实现不可修改功

在repeater控件绑定时,如何根据条件改变字体的颜色

问题描述 在repeater控件绑定时,如何根据条件改变字体的颜色 前台代码: <table border='0' align='center' cellpadding='5' cellspacing='2' class='Data2'> <tr class = 'Data_Header'> <%if (Session["zdcx_jbleixing"].ToString() == "2") {%> <td nowrap=&

给Gridview绑定数据,数据是存在项目里的, 求帮谢谢!运行下面代码报错:当控件被数据绑定时,无法以编程方式向 DataGridView 的行集合中添加行

问题描述 #region绑定DataGridView方法privatevoidDataGridViewBind(){DataTabledtSupplier=_SupplierFacade.GetSMSupplierContacterInfoByFid(iSupplierID);DataViewdvSupplier=dtSupplier.DefaultView;//((DataTable)dgvSupplierContInfo.DataSource).Rows.Add();dvSupplier.S

使用Eval()绑定时,如果内容为&amp;amp;lt;br&amp;amp;gt;之类的标签,如何正常的显示,急

问题描述 使用Eval()绑定时,如果内容为<br>之类的标签,如何正常的显示,急 解决方案 解决方案二:你可以先将数据库总所有<br>之类的替换成<br>就ok了解决方案三:Eval()+"<BR/>"解决方案四:引用楼主u3978407的回复: 使用Eval()绑定时,如果内容为<br>之类的标签,如何正常的显示,急 该正常显示就正常显示.如果你不使用Eval绑定,就是直接写<BR/>,它能"正常显示

qlist-qt中的QList类,在遍历一遍后链表变为空是怎么回事

问题描述 qt中的QList类,在遍历一遍后链表变为空是怎么回事 我在qt中使用QList存储了一个自定义的数据结构,在对这个数据结构的内容取值后整个链表变为空的链表,不知道这是怎么回事 解决方案 你的"取值"方法有问题,变更了QList内容. 解决方案二: 没删?或者给头重新赋值了? 解决方案三: 是不是在遍历过程中被再一次实例化了? 解决方案四: 你要输出链表的话,可以用at(),而不是takeAt(),takeAt()是删除链表中的元素 3是长度 takeAt(0),删掉了第一个

背水一战 Windows 10 (33) - 控件(选择类): ListBox, RadioButton, CheckBox, ToggleSwitch

原文:背水一战 Windows 10 (33) - 控件(选择类): ListBox, RadioButton, CheckBox, ToggleSwitch [源码下载] 背水一战 Windows 10 (33) - 控件(选择类): ListBox, RadioButton, CheckBox, ToggleSwitch 作者:webabcd 介绍背水一战 Windows 10 之 控件(选择类) ListBox RadioButton CheckBox ToggleSwitch 示例1.L

csocket-CSocket类中OnReceive()函数被重写后,为什么还要调用CSocket::OnReceive.

问题描述 CSocket类中OnReceive()函数被重写后,为什么还要调用CSocket::OnReceive. 1.CSocket类中OnReceive()函数被重写后,为什么还要调用CSocket::OnReceive. 2.被重写的Onreceive()函数什么时候会被调用,该函数中使用了Receive()方法.我没有使用定时器机制,会不会造成阻塞. 感谢您的耐心解答 解决方案 (1)派生类要做的事情属于基类要做的事情再加上一些别的事情的情况,需要调用基类.派生类做的事情属于完全不同基

cview子类 mfc类 mfc-手动添加继承MFCView的类subView,创建subView实例后电脑CPU占用率猛增

问题描述 手动添加继承MFCView的类subView,创建subView实例后电脑CPU占用率猛增 如下图:我在创建MFC的子类的时候选择了C++ Class,而并非MFC Class:然后自己指定了基类为CWiew.http://pan.baidu.com/s/1c0y32kKhttp://pan.baidu.com/s/1pJpZ8AR 然后我就创建test的实例,结果运行程序后CPU达到60%,这是什么原因呢?